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/logging/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Windows phone 8 将数据从一页发送到另一页_Windows Phone 8 - Fatal编程技术网

Windows phone 8 将数据从一页发送到另一页

Windows phone 8 将数据从一页发送到另一页,windows-phone-8,Windows Phone 8,我有一个严重的问题。 我有两个页面(例如设置页面和主页)。在settingpage中,我有一个带有两个值的开关按钮(English和China) 我想在单击开关按钮时不要将表单page1导航到page2以发送数据,但我想更改page2上的一些数据,例如格式编号和。。。无需导航或更改页面。 我怎么能做到? 谢谢。有几种方法可以实现这一点 在任何页面上创建一个静态变量,并将其用作PageName.variableName来访问该变量或设置其值 使用单件 我认为这在WindowsPhone8中是不可

我有一个严重的问题。
我有两个页面(例如
设置页面
主页
)。在
settingpage
中,我有一个带有两个值的
开关按钮(
English
China

我想在单击
开关按钮时
不要将表单
page1
导航到
page2
以发送数据,但我想更改
page2
上的一些数据,例如格式编号和。。。无需导航或更改页面。
我怎么能做到?
谢谢。

有几种方法可以实现这一点

  • 在任何页面上创建一个静态变量,并将其用作
    PageName.variableName
    来访问该变量或设置其值
  • 使用单件
    我认为这在WindowsPhone8中是不可能的。您可以将数据存储在持久性中,并在转到其他页面时显示它们。您可以做的另一件事是使用母版页,这样您就可以访问两个屏幕中的相同数据。